Изображение в Base64 Converter для веб, кода и электронной почты

Конвертируйте изображения в Base64 онлайн с помощью этого бесплатного инструмента Image to Base64. Загрузите изображение и немедленно получите готовую к использованию строку Base64 для HTML, CSS, электронной почты или кода. Идеально подходит для студентов, изучающих веб-разработку, учителей, объясняющих концепции кодирования, и разработчиков, встраивающих изображения непосредственно в проекты. Быстрая, простая, не требуется регистрация и работает непосредственно в вашем браузере.
Изображение в Base64 Converter для веб, кода и электронной почты

Этот инструмент вам помог?

3.9/5 от 32 рейтинги

Преобразуйте изображения в строки Base64 мгновенно для веб-сайтов, кода и безопасной обработки данных.

Введение

Изображения являются ключевой частью веб-сайтов, заданий и цифрового контента, но иногда работа с файлами изображений напрямую не является лучшим вариантом. Студенту, изучающему веб-разработку, может быть предложено встроить изображения в HTML или CSS. Учитель, объясняющий концепции кодирования, может продемонстрировать, как данные изображения могут храниться в виде текста. Разработчику может потребоваться отправлять изображения через системы, которые поддерживают только текстовые форматы.

Именно здесь кодирование Base64 становится важным. Вместо использования отдельного файла изображения изображение преобразуется в длинную текстовую строку. Однако понимание или создание этих закодированных данных вручную непрактично. Без надлежащего инструмента пользователи могут изо всех сил пытаться конвертировать изображения, особенно если у них нет опыта кодирования.

Изображение для Base64 Конвертер решает эту проблему, мгновенно превращая изображения в строки Base64. Вы загружаете изображение, конвертируете клики и получаете готовый к использованию закодированный вывод, который можно использовать в HTML, CSS или приложениях. Он прост, быстр и предназначен как для начинающих, так и для продвинутых пользователей.

Что делает этот инструмент

Этот инструмент преобразует файлы изображений в закодированные строки Base64. Base64 - это метод кодирования двоичного текста, который позволяет представлять данные изображения в виде простого текста. Это позволяет встраивать изображения непосредственно в теги HTML или свойства фона CSS.

Процесс прост. Вы загружаете файл изображения, такой как JPG, PNG, GIF, BMP, TIFF или аналогичные форматы:contentReference[oaicite:0]{index=0}. После загрузки инструмент обрабатывает изображение и преобразует его в строку Base64 в течение нескольких секунд. Вывод может быть скопирован и использован непосредственно в коде или проекте.

Этот инструмент работает непосредственно в браузере и не требует установки или регистрации. Он предназначен для скорости и простоты, что делает его полезным для студентов, преподавателей и разработчиков, которым нужны быстрые результаты без дополнительных шагов.

Еще одна ключевая особенность — точность. Процесс преобразования гарантирует, что строка Base64 правильно представляет исходное изображение, позволяя ему правильно отображаться при использовании в веб-среде или среде приложений.

Он также поддерживает быструю интеграцию рабочих процессов. Пользователи могут мгновенно скопировать закодированную строку и вставить ее в свой HTML, CSS или JSON без необходимости дополнительного форматирования. Это уменьшает количество ошибок и делает процесс более эффективным как для начинающих, так и для профессионалов.

Почему важно конвертировать изображения в Base64

Преобразование Base64 широко используется в современной веб-разработке и цифровой коммуникации. Одним из основных преимуществ является сокращение HTTP-запросов. Вместо отдельной загрузки изображений они могут быть встроены непосредственно в HTML или CSS, что улучшает производительность загрузки страницы :contentReference[oaicite:1]{index=1}.

Это также улучшает обработку данных. Поскольку Base64 преобразует двоичные данные в текст, становится проще отправлять изображения через системы, предназначенные для текстовой связи, такие как API, файлы JSON или шаблоны электронной почты.

Для студентов это помогает понять, как кодирование данных работает в реальных приложениях. Для учителей это обеспечивает четкий способ продемонстрировать, как изображения могут быть интегрированы в код. Для разработчиков это практичное решение для встраивания небольших изображений непосредственно в веб-проекты.

Еще одним преимуществом является последовательность. Base64 гарантирует, что изображения последовательно отображаются на разных платформах, не полагаясь на внешние пути файлов, которые могут сломаться или выйти из строя.

Кроме того, он улучшает портативность. Когда все ресурсы встроены в один файл, проекты могут быть легко разделены, не беспокоясь об отсутствующих изображениях или неработающих ссылках. Это особенно полезно для заданий и демонстраций.

Почему встраиваемые изображения важны для веб-разработки

Встраивание изображений непосредственно в HTML или CSS с помощью Base64 может упростить структуру проекта. Вместо того, чтобы управлять несколькими файлами изображений и путями, все может содержаться в одном файле. Это особенно полезно для небольших значков, логотипов или элементов пользовательского интерфейса.

Для студентов, работающих над проектами, это снижает сложность. Им не нужно беспокоиться об отсутствующих файлах или неправильных путях. Для разработчиков это может улучшить производительность в определенных случаях, особенно при работе с небольшими изображениями, которые часто используются.

Однако важно грамотно использовать Base64. Большие изображения могут увеличить размер файла при кодировании, поэтому этот метод лучше всего подходит для небольших и средних изображений. Этот инструмент помогает пользователям экспериментировать и понимать, когда Base64 является правильным выбором.

Он также поддерживает более быстрое прототипирование. Разработчики могут быстро тестировать макеты и проекты без настройки файловых структур. Это делает раннюю стадию развития более гладкой и гибкой.

Используйте случаи

1. Встраивание изображений в HTML:
Ситуация: Студент создает веб-страницу и хочет включать изображения без использования внешних файлов.
Проблема: Управление путями и файлами изображений становится запутанным.
Решение: Студент преобразует изображение в Base64 и встраивает его непосредственно в HTML-код.
Результат: веб-страница работает без внешних зависимостей, что облегчает управление проектом.

2. Фоновые изображения CSS:
Ситуация: Разработчик хочет использовать небольшие значки в качестве фоновых изображений в CSS.
Проблема: несколько HTTP-запросов замедляют работу страницы.
Решение: Разработчик преобразует изображения в Base64 и использует их непосредственно в CSS.
Результат: снижение запросов и улучшение производительности.

3. Шаблоны электронной почты:
Ситуация: Дизайнер создает шаблон электронной почты с изображениями.
Проблема: Внешние ссылки изображений могут не загружаться в некоторых почтовых клиентах.
Решение: Изображения преобразуются в Base64 и встраиваются напрямую.
Результат: электронная почта отображается правильно на разных платформах.

4. Обучение в классе:
Ситуация: Учитель объясняет, как можно закодировать данные изображения.
Проблема: Студенты не могут визуализировать, как текст представляет изображения.
Решение: Учитель использует этот инструмент для преобразования и демонстрации процесса.
Результат: студенты более четко понимают концепции кодирования.

5. API и обработка данных JSON:
Ситуация: Разработчик должен отправлять изображения через API.
Проблема: API поддерживает только текстовые данные.
Решение: Изображение преобразуется в Base64 и отправляется в виде текста.
Результат: изображение успешно передается без проблем с обработкой файлов.

6. Быстрая конверсия для проектов:
Ситуация: Студент получает изображение, но нуждается в нем в формате Base64.
Проблема: Студент не знает, как закодировать его вручную.
Решение: Изображение загружается и преобразуется мгновенно.
Строка Base64 готова к использованию без дополнительных усилий.

Пример реального мира

Представьте себе студента, работающего над заданием по веб-разработке. Студент должен создать веб-страницу с изображениями, встроенными непосредственно в HTML-файл. Вместо того, чтобы связывать отдельные файлы изображений, назначение требует использования кодирования Base64.

Студент загружает изображение в этот инструмент и преобразует его в строку Base64. Выход копируется и помещается внутри тега HTML . При открытии страницы изображение отображается правильно, без необходимости использования внешнего файла.

Такой подход упрощает проект и гарантирует, что все работает в одном файле. Это также помогает студенту понять, как кодирование работает в реальном мире. Преподаватели могут использовать тот же пример для демонстрации концепций в классе, делая уроки более практичными и увлекательными.

Другой реальный сценарий — когда разработчик создает небольшой веб-компонент и хочет избежать управления несколькими файлами активов. Встраивая изображения Base64, разработчик удерживает все в одном месте, снижая сложность и повышая эффективность рабочего процесса.

Как этот инструмент сравнивается с другими инструментами

Многие преобразователи Base64 предназначены для технических пользователей. Этот инструмент фокусируется на простоте и удобстве использования для всех уровней навыков.

ОсобенностьКлассные инструменты24Типичные инструменты
Бесплатно использовать100% бесплатно без ограничений.Часто ограничены или оплачены.
Без подписиРаботает мгновенно без учета.Может потребоваться логин.
Поддерживаемые форматыJPG, PNG, GIF, BMP, TIFF и многое другое.Ограниченные форматы.
СкоростьБыстрое преобразование в секунды.Может быть медленнее.
Простота использованияПростой процесс загрузки и конвертации.Может быть сложным.
Копировать выходЛегкая копия строки Base64.Требуется ручной отбор.
конфиденциальностьНет ненужного хранения данных.Может отслеживать загрузки.
Фокус на образованиеПолезно для обучения и преподавания.Только общего назначения.

часто задаваемые вопросы

Что такое конверсия Base64?

Он преобразует файл изображения в текстовую строку, которая представляет данные изображения.

Где можно использовать Base64?

Вы можете использовать их в HTML, CSS, шаблонах электронной почты и API.

Нужны ли мне знания кодирования?

Нет, просто загрузите изображение и скопируйте выход.

Этот инструмент бесплатный?

Да, совершенно бесплатно.

Можно ли конвертировать несколько форматов?

Да, он поддерживает общие форматы изображений, такие как JPG, PNG и многое другое.

Можно ли вернуть изображение?

Да, используйте Base64 To Image для декодирования изображения.